He is the son of Abraham who is the forefather of faith. However, Isaac had undesirable competitor. That competitor was the king of that region and his name was Abimelech. Today as we look at the life of Isaac, we can see the mistakes he makes. Going after his father Abraham, Isaac does the same thing and almost sold his wife. It is not the same human trafficking we see today. In order to save his own life, he lied and said that his wife as his sibling. That is why king Abimelech tried to take Rebecca as his own. That is when God intercepts and blocks this. Abimelech thought it was okay to take his wife because Isaac told him that it was his sibling. But God intercepts, and Abimelech wasn’t able to do so. In Abimelech’s perspective, he was lied to and because he was told something un-factual he almost sinned because of Isaac so he had a very uncomfortable heart. So, he quickly returns Issacs’s wife. This kind of backdrop due to Rebecca was between Isaac and Abimelech. But as time passed, Isaac was growing wealthier. Because Isaac was growing wealthier and had a lot of servants, King Abimelech was growing anxious. That when King Abimelech tries to kick out Isaac’s house hold. At that time, Isaac did not hold any riot to argue saying “I purchased this land and I have the right to live on this land.” All the wells that Isaac dug out was being stolen away. Isaac has many reasons to fight and argue back however, Isaac yielded. The more Isaac yielded, the better things turned out. He would go some place else and dig a well and find a source of water. Whenever they would farm, they would grow crops a 100 years worthy. He was able to claim this large piece of land. The bible says that he became more prominent and wealthy. That is why king Abimelech had a change in heart. Isaac had enough wealthy and man power to influence the king. That is when the king come to find Isaac himself. Because he can’t go by himself, he takes his warriors with him. And that is today’s scripture of Gen.26. Isaac is very surprised and asks, “why have to come to me who was very hostile to me?” Then the king says, “we saw clearly that the lord was with you. Let there be an oath between us. Let’s not hate each other and not engage in war. Because you have been gratefully blessed, may you show the same blessing. Can you make this an agreement between us? Let’s make an oath.” This is what the King said. He also said, “Since you have been blessed by God, let there be no harm between us. What does that mean? Abimelech who used to regard Isaac as his competition, he goes to him first to have this favorable relationship. He said, “let us not fight one another but have harmony with one another.” If you truly analyze this situation, Abimelech is getting down to his knee asking for his mercy. This is the answer of the summit. In Isaac’s point of view, he won without fighting. That is how God molded that situation. It can’t just like that either. 2. The me that held onto covenant of God. (Gen.3:15; 25:25; Jn.3:16)

What is the second fact that Isaac knew? Isaac knew and held on to the covenant of God. He knew the fact that his father was chosen by God. When Isaac observed his father closely, he noticed that his father built an alter to the Lord and gave worship. He saw through his father during the designated time Abraham built an alter to give worship. If you look in the old testament, the form of worship at that time was blood sacrifice. They had to take the lamb and shed its blood and burn the blood. Because the lamb is being sacrificed, it is called sacrificial worship. The reason why sacrificial worship was the type of worship at the time of the old testament because it resembled the future of Jesus who will shed his blood on the cross. The savior that God will send to us, he will be sacrificed in order to save us. In our place, He will be sacrificed for us. Not only that he overcame the forces of darkness and resurrected. What does this all signify? It means that Satan, the one who is trying to trick us with the forces of death and darkness in order to control mankind. If you look at Satan, his greatest tool is death, but Jesus overcame this, and he resurrected. This is Jesus shattering the head of Satan. That is why the sacrificial worship is showing the faith that the messiah will come as the sacrifice that will overturn and bring of the head of death and Satan. He observed and followed after the faith of his father Abraham. That is why Isaac, just as his father did, built an alter and gave worship to God. That is why the covenant that is given is the savior Lord the sacrificial lamb and that is the covenant that he held on to. Do you believe in this? That is why John3:16 is a very famous verse.
